免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发者必须关注的新技术

随着移动应用市场的快速发展,作为一名app开发者,了解和掌握最新的技术是非常重要的。本文将介绍一些app开发者必须关注的新技术,包括原理和详细介绍。

1. 人工智能和机器学习:人工智能和机器学习是当前炙手可热的技术领域。在app开发中,人工智能和机器学习可以用于实现自然语言处理、图像识别、推荐系统等功能。开发者可以利用开源的机器学习框架如TensorFlow、PyTorch等来构建和训练模型,然后将其集成到自己的app中。

2. 增强现实和虚拟现实:增强现实(AR)和虚拟现实(VR)技术正在逐渐渗透到移动应用领域。通过使用AR和VR技术,开发者可以为用户提供更加沉浸式的体验。AR技术可以通过手机摄像头将虚拟内容叠加在现实世界中,而VR技术则可以让用户完全沉浸在虚拟世界中。开发者可以利用ARKit(iOS)和ARCore(Android)等框架来实现AR功能,利用Google Cardboard和Oculus Rift等设备来实现VR功能。

3. 5G技术:随着5G技术的逐渐普及,移动应用的性能和速度将得到极大的提升。5G技术将带来更低的延迟和更高的带宽,使得app可以更快地加载和响应用户的操作。对于app开发者来说,他们需要了解和适配5G网络,以确保自己的app在5G环境下能够正常运行,并且能够充分利用5G的优势。

4. 前端框架和工具:在移动应用开发中,前端开发非常重要。随着前端技术的不断发展,出现了许多优秀的前端框架和工具,如React Native、Flutter、Vue.js等。这些框架和工具可以帮助开发者快速构建跨平台的移动应用,并提供良好的用户体验。开发者可以根据自己的需求选择合适的前端框架和工具,并学习其使用方法和原理。

5. 安全和隐私保护:随着移动应用的普及,用户对于隐私和数据安全的关注也越来越高。作为app开发者,必须要注意保护用户的隐私和数据安全。开发者可以采用加密技术、安全认证和权限管理等手段来保护用户的数据安全。此外,合规性也是一个重要的问题,开发者需要了解和遵守相关的法规和标准,如GDPR(通用数据保护条例)等。

总之,作为app开发者,了解和掌握最新的技术是非常重要的。本文介绍了一些app开发者必须关注的新技术,包括人工智能和机器学习、增强现实和虚拟现实、5G技术、前端框架和工具以及安全和隐私保护。开发者可以根据自己的需求和兴趣选择学习和应用这些技术,以提升自己的开发能力和用户体验。


相关知识:
汽车加油app开发的作用
随着汽车的普及和人们对出行的需求不断增加,汽车加油的需求也越来越大。为了更好地满足人们的需求,汽车加油app应运而生。本文将从原理和详细介绍两个方面来介绍汽车加油app的作用。一、原理汽车加油app的原理其实很简单,它主要是通过手机APP将消费者和加油站连
2024-01-10
h5开发app连接数据库
H5开发APP连接数据库是一种常见的需求,可以通过使用Web技术和相关的JavaScript库来实现。在本文中,将对H5开发APP连接数据库的原理和详细介绍进行解释。H5是指基于HTML5、CSS3和JavaScript的Web技术,可以用于构建跨平台的W
2023-07-14
app开发扫码
扫码技术是近年来在移动应用开发领域中广泛应用的一种功能。它通过使用摄像头捕捉二维码或条形码的图像,并将其解码成可识别的信息。在本文中,我将详细介绍扫码技术的原理和实现。一、扫码原理扫码技术的原理主要包括图像捕捉、图像处理和解码三个步骤。1. 图像捕捉:扫码
2023-06-29
app开发中如何实现多国语言
在app开发中,实现多国语言是非常重要的,它可以帮助你的应用程序更好地适应不同地区的用户。本文将介绍实现多国语言的原理和详细步骤。1. 原理实现多国语言的原理是根据用户的语言设置来加载相应的语言资源文件。当用户切换语言时,应用程序会重新加载对应语言的资源文
2023-06-29
app常用开发流程简述
App开发可以分为几个流程:需求分析、UI设计、后端开发、前端开发、测试和部署。每个流程都有其独特的特性,以下是每个流程的详细介绍。1. 需求分析需求分析是应用程序开发的第一个步骤。在这个阶段,我们需要仔细分析客户的需求,并确立我们应用程序的目标。我们应该
2023-05-06
app定制开发和模板成品区别
在移动互联网时代,移动应用程序(App)已经成为人们日常生活中必不可少的工具之一。而对于企业或个人而言,开发一款能够满足自身应用需求的App是非常必要的。在这个背景下,App的定制开发和模板成品应运而生,那么二者之间到底有什么区别呢?一、定义区别app定制
2023-05-06